AI入门指南:零基础学习路线图
分类:AI教程 浏览量:194
人工智能(AI)是计算机科学的一个分支,旨在创造能够模拟人类智能的机器和系统。它涉及到机器学习、自然语言处理、计算机视觉等多个领域。通过这些技术,计算机能够执行通常需要人类智能的任务,如理解语言、识别图像、解决问题等。随着技术的不断进步,人工智能已经从理论研究逐渐走向实际应用,改变了我们生活的方方面面。
在我看来,人工智能不仅仅是一个技术概念,更是一种全新的思维方式。它促使我们重新审视人与机器之间的关系,以及如何利用这些工具来提升我们的工作效率和生活质量。随着人工智能的不断发展,我相信它将会在未来的社会中扮演越来越重要的角色。
如果你对学习人工智能感兴趣,可以参考这篇文章《我想学 AI 从哪里入手 2026 零基础 AI 入门完整学习路线图》,它为初学者提供了详细的学习路径和资源。此外,了解相关的技术和工具也很重要,你可以查看这篇文章以获取更多信息:相关学习资源。通过这些资料,你可以更好地规划自己的学习进程,逐步掌握人工智能的核心概念和技能。
人工智能的发展历程
人工智能的发展历程可以追溯到20世纪50年代。当时,科学家们开始探索如何让机器具备类似人类的思维能力。1956年,达特茅斯会议被认为是人工智能正式诞生的标志。在这次会议上,众多科学家聚集在一起,讨论如何让机器进行学习和推理。此后,人工智能经历了几次高潮与低谷,尤其是在70年代和80年代,由于技术限制和资金短缺,研究进展缓慢。
进入21世纪后,随着计算能力的提升和大数据的出现,人工智能迎来了新的发展机遇。深度学习技术的崛起使得机器在图像识别、语音识别等领域取得了显著进展。我亲眼见证了这一变化,从最初的简单算法到如今复杂的神经网络,人工智能的发展速度令人惊叹。如今,人工智能已经成为科技界的热门话题,各大公司纷纷投入资源进行研究和开发。
人工智能的应用领域
人工智能的应用领域非常广泛,几乎涵盖了我们生活的每一个角落。在医疗领域,AI被用于疾病诊断、药物研发和个性化治疗等方面。例如,通过分析大量医学数据,AI可以帮助医生更准确地诊断疾病,提高治疗效果。在金融行业,人工智能被用于风险评估、欺诈检测和投资决策等环节,大大提高了工作效率。
此外,在交通运输、教育、制造业等领域,人工智能也展现出了巨大的潜力。在交通领域,自动驾驶技术正在逐步成熟,有望减少交通事故,提高出行效率。在教育方面,AI可以根据学生的学习情况提供个性化的学习方案,帮助他们更好地掌握知识。我认为,随着技术的不断进步,人工智能将在更多领域发挥重要作用,推动社会的发展与变革。
学习人工智能的必备基础知识
要学习人工智能,我认为掌握一些基础知识是非常重要的。首先,计算机科学的基本概念是必不可少的,包括数据结构、算法和编程基础。这些知识将为我理解更复杂的AI概念打下坚实的基础。此外,我还需要了解机器学习和深度学习的基本原理,这些是实现人工智能的重要技术。
其次,我认为数学知识也是学习人工智能的重要组成部分。线性代数、概率论和统计学是理解机器学习算法的关键。我在学习过程中发现,很多AI算法都依赖于数学模型,因此掌握这些基础知识将有助于我更深入地理解和应用相关技术。通过不断学习和实践,我相信我能够在这个领域取得更大的进步。
如果你对学习人工智能感兴趣,可以参考这篇文章,它提供了一个详细的学习路线图,适合零基础的初学者。通过这篇文章,你可以了解到从基础知识到进阶技能的全面学习路径,帮助你更好地掌握AI的核心概念和技术。想要获取更多信息,可以查看这篇相关的文章我想学 AI 从哪里入手 2026 零基础 AI 入门完整学习路线图。
学习人工智能的编程语言
| 阶段 | 学习内容 | 时间 |
|---|---|---|
| 1 | 学习Python基础 | 1-2个月 |
| 2 | 学习数据分析和可视化 | 2-3个月 |
| 3 | 学习机器学习基础 | 3-4个月 |
| 4 | 学习深度学习 | 4-5个月 |
| 5 | 实践项目和综合实战 | 6个月以上 |
在学习人工智能的过程中,选择合适的编程语言至关重要。目前,Python是最受欢迎的人工智能编程语言之一。它具有简洁易懂的语法,并且拥有丰富的库和框架,如TensorFlow、Keras和PyTorch等,这些工具可以大大简化我的开发过程。此外,Python在数据处理和分析方面也表现出色,使我能够轻松处理大规模数据集。
除了Python之外,我还发现R语言在数据分析和统计建模方面具有独特优势。对于需要进行复杂数据分析的项目,我会考虑使用R语言。此外,Java和C++等语言也在某些特定场景下被广泛应用。我认为,根据项目需求选择合适的编程语言,将有助于我更高效地完成任务。
如果你对学习人工智能感兴趣,可以参考这篇文章,它提供了一个详细的学习路线图,适合零基础的初学者。文章中不仅介绍了基础知识,还涵盖了进阶内容,帮助你逐步掌握 AI 技能。想要了解更多信息,可以点击这里查看相关内容 学习路线图。通过这篇文章,你将能够更清晰地规划自己的学习路径。
掌握人工智能的数学基础
数学是理解和应用人工智能的重要工具。在我的学习过程中,我发现线性代数是许多机器学习算法的基础。矩阵运算、特征值分解等概念在深度学习中尤为重要。此外,概率论和统计学也是不可或缺的,它们帮助我理解数据分布、模型评估等关键问题。
我还意识到微积分在优化算法中的重要性。许多机器学习模型都需要通过优化算法来调整参数,以提高模型性能。因此,掌握微积分将使我能够更好地理解这些算法背后的原理。我相信,通过扎实的数学基础,我能够更深入地探索人工智能领域,并在实际应用中取得更好的效果。
学习人工智能的算法和模型
在学习人工智能时,了解各种算法和模型是至关重要的一步。我发现机器学习可以分为监督学习、无监督学习和强化学习三大类。监督学习通过已有标签的数据进行训练,而无监督学习则是在没有标签的数据中寻找模式。强化学习则通过与环境互动来优化决策过程。这些不同类型的学习方法各有特点,我会根据具体问题选择合适的方法。
此外,我还需要熟悉一些常用的机器学习算法,如线性回归、决策树、支持向量机和神经网络等。这些算法各自适用于不同类型的数据和问题。在我的实践中,我会尝试使用这些算法解决实际问题,以加深对它们的理解。我相信,通过不断地学习和实践,我能够掌握这些算法,并在未来的项目中灵活运用。
人工智能的学习资源推荐
在学习人工智能的过程中,有许多优秀的资源可以帮助我提升自己的技能。我常常利用在线课程平台,如Coursera、edX和Udacity等,这些平台提供了丰富的AI课程,从基础到高级都有覆盖。此外,一些知名大学也开设了相关课程,我会积极参与这些课程,以获取系统性的知识。
除了在线课程,我还喜欢阅读相关书籍,如《深度学习》、《机器学习》以及《统计学习方法》等。这些书籍不仅提供了理论知识,还包含了大量实例,有助于我更好地理解复杂概念。此外,我还会关注一些技术博客和论坛,与其他学习者交流经验,共同进步。我相信,通过多种渠道获取知识,我能够更全面地掌握人工智能。
人工智能的实践项目
实践是巩固理论知识的重要环节。在我的学习过程中,我尝试参与了一些实际项目,以将所学知识应用于现实问题。例如,我曾参与一个图像识别项目,通过使用卷积神经网络(CNN)来识别不同种类的植物。这不仅让我加深了对深度学习模型的理解,还让我体验到了团队合作的重要性。
此外,我还尝试过自然语言处理项目,通过构建聊天机器人来实现与用户的互动。在这个过程中,我学会了如何处理文本数据,并应用相关算法进行情感分析。这些实践项目让我认识到理论与实践相结合的重要性,也让我更加坚定了在人工智能领域发展的决心。我相信,通过不断参与实践项目,我能够积累丰富的经验,为未来的发展打下坚实基础。
人工智能的职业发展
随着人工智能技术的发展,相关职业也日益增多。我发现,从事人工智能相关工作的岗位包括数据科学家、机器学习工程师、AI研究员等。这些职位不仅要求扎实的技术能力,还需要良好的沟通能力和团队合作精神。在我的职业规划中,我希望能够成为一名优秀的数据科学家,通过分析数据为企业提供决策支持。
为了实现这个目标,我会不断提升自己的技能,包括编程能力、数学基础以及对行业动态的了解。此外,我还计划参加一些行业会议,与专家交流经验,从中获取灵感。我相信,在这个快速发展的领域,只要我保持学习热情,就一定能够找到适合自己的职业发展道路。
人工智能的未来发展趋势
展望未来,我认为人工智能将继续以惊人的速度发展。随着计算能力的提升和数据量的增加,AI将在更多领域实现突破。例如,在医疗健康方面,AI有望通过精准医疗改善患者治疗效果;在交通运输领域,无人驾驶技术将逐步普及,提高出行安全性。此外,AI与物联网、大数据等技术结合,将推动智慧城市的发展,实现更高效的资源管理。
同时,我也意识到人工智能的发展带来了许多挑战,如伦理问题、隐私保护等。在未来,我们需要更加关注这些问题,以确保技术的发展能够造福全人类。我相信,在不断探索与创新中,我们将迎来一个更加美好的未来。
FAQs
1. 什么是人工智能(AI)?
人工智能(AI)是一种模拟人类智能的技术,包括学习、推理、问题解决和自我改进等能力。它可以应用于各种领域,如医疗保健、金融、交通等。
2. 零基础学习人工智能需要哪些基础知识?
学习人工智能的基础知识包括数学(如线性代数、微积分)、编程语言(如Python)、机器学习和深度学习等概念。
3. 如何开始学习人工智能?
想要学习人工智能,可以从在线课程、教科书、博客等资源入手。同时,也可以参加相关的培训课程或加入人工智能社区,与其他学习者交流经验。
4. 有哪些学习人工智能的完整学习路线图?
学习人工智能的完整学习路线图包括学习基础数学知识、学习编程语言、深入了解机器学习和深度学习等内容,最终可以通过实践项目来巩固所学知识。
5. 学习人工智能需要多长时间?
学习人工智能的时间因人而异,通常需要数月到数年的时间来掌握相关知识和技能。持续的实践和学习是提高技能的关键。


